Episode #52 - It’s an Awesome Sandwich
With your hosts Kimberly, Melody, and Sarah.
Performance Review (00:51) - “The Carpet” - We have JAM sandwiches, Kevin practicing his breathing, Pam and Roy share that “one” joke, while Michael loves being the butt of another.
Email Surveillance (27:13) - Fans want to see more Stanley, and so do we. Who’s Toby’s ex? More on who started first, Jim or Pam. Did Creed actually wear the shirt that he gave Jim in “Christmas Party”? And we have a new voicemail number: (646) 495-9201 x 88488
Scranton Scoop (38:02)
- “The Office” moves to Chile
- “Office” nomination for Producers Guild Award
- Angela and Oscar to be on “Last Comic Standing”
Fandomnicity (39:43)
- “The 305″, a parody between “The Office” and “300.”
- A blog dedicated to the elusive Marjorie
- Mindy and Brenda once wrote a pilot for the WB
- Jenna Fischer clears up some rumors on her blog

Episode #50 - Motivational King of the World
With your hosts Melody and Sarah.
Performance Review (1:00): “Booze Cruise” - Michael thinks he’s finally figured out that booze is the secret to a successful party, despite hoping he’ll motivate his employees to do something other than throw up. Katy shows up, Jim and Pam don’t make out, Dwight steers the ship, and Angela wants us to run aground. In the end, Michael’s more successful than he’ll probably ever realize.
Email Surveillance (27:59): Jan and Michael’s first Christmas together, and Dwight and Michael’s respective fantasy lives.
Scranton Scoop (35:05):
- “Office” quotes made a good showing on Entertainment Weekly’s list of funniest TV lines of 2007
- Jenna Fischer has landed on USA Today’s Pop Candy Blog’s Top 100 People of 2007 at #12
- Vote for “The Office” in TV.com’s Best of 2007 poll in the “Best in Genre Comedy” category
- Rainn Wilson will be hosting The Film Independent Spirit awards on February 23rd
- From The Hollywood Reporter: David Denman and Zach Braff team up on a new drama pilot for FOX called “Saints of Circumstance”
Fandomnicity (38:58):
- Best Week Ever presents their 13 reasons to miss The Office, or why the Writers Strike is Killing Us
- Office Tally has a post up with the Office theme song in various formats to use as a ringtone
- 4AMInsomniac’s Office video tribute to the Free Hugs Campaign
- The Two Cents has relaunched its Office site, Scranton Branch Office
